我从各种各样的人那里听说可编程以太网卡存在且容易获得。然而,我还没有能够追踪其中一个神秘的设备,所以我想知道它们是否就是那个 - 一个神话。
这种可编程卡具有千兆以太网接口,具有可编程CPU并通过PCI Express连接到主机系统。这些卡解决的问题区域是低延迟网络应用程序,其中卡本身完成工作并“报告”回操作系统。基本上,该卡充当协处理器并处理卡上的所有低延迟要求,从而避免了在用户区写入低延迟代码的问题 - 认为响应时间为0.4ms - 0.5ms。
所以我的问题是,这些卡真的存在吗?如果是的话,我可以在哪里拿到一张?
答案 0 :(得分:3)
AdvancedIO具有双路和四路可编程10 gbe PCI Express卡。这些卡适用于超低延迟和线速应用(高频交易,军事和电信)。它们使用FPGA而不是CPU,因为FPGA具有较低的延迟,可以实时处理大量数据。
如果您想了解有关这些卡片的更多信息,请访问: http://www.advancedio.com/products/form-factor/pci-express/
如果您想了解有关应用程序的更多信息,可以访问:http://www.advancedio.com/markets/financial/或浏览网站上的其他市场。
这些卡附带了一个开发框架,以方便应用程序的开发。
祝你好运答案 1 :(得分:2)
RNet技术具有用户可编程NIC,可通过软件编程,而不是基于FPGA(硬件可编程)的高级I / O卡。
答案 2 :(得分:0)
Bigfoot Networks制作了一系列产品(他们的 Killer 系列),这些产品是“智能”网卡:例如: Killer 2100。
目前尚不清楚他们目前的产品是否是用户可编程的。但是,a review of a legacy product of theirs表示您至少可以在卡片上加载专门的“应用”。